Mackerel Pate
By Mamaharris
Makes quite a bit so any left overs can be frozen. I serve this with fresh chunks of bread, toast or Melba toast.A bit rich but well worth it.

Ingredients
- 12 oz smoked mackerel,skinned and boned
- 6 oz butter, melted
- 4 oz double cream
- 3 tbsp lemon juice
- salt and pepper
- pinch cayenne
Details
servings 8
Level of difficulty Average
Preparation time 10mins
Cost Average budget
Preparation
Step 1
Put mackerel into a liquidizer and blend with just enough butter to make it smooth.
Step 2
Turn into a bowl and gradually add the remaining butter and lemon juice and seasoning.
Step 3
Put into serving dish, sprinkle cayenne pepper and chill
